(a) The virtues of the Buddha’s body

This entails recollection of the Buddha’s auspicious signs and exemplary

features. Recall them as they are taught in the Praise by Example:

Your body, adorned with the signs,

Your eyes are beautiful elixirs,

Like a cloudless autumn sky

Decorated with clusters of stars.

o golden Sage,

Beautifully draped with religious robes

You are like a golden mountain peak

Wrapped in the clouds of sunrise or sunset.

o protector, even the full moon

Free of clouds cannot compare

With the radiant orb of your face

Free of the embellishment of jewelry.

Should a bee see

The lotus of your face

And a lotus opened by the sun,

It would wonder which was the real lotus.

Your white teeth beautify

Your golden face

Like pure moonbeams in autumn pouring through

The gaps between golden mountains.

o one so worthy of worship, your right hand,

Adorned with the sign of the wheel,

Makes the gesture of relief

To people terrified by cyclic existence.

o Sage, when you walk,

Your feet leave marks on this earth

Like splendid lotuses-

How can it be beautified by lotus gardens?

(b) The virtues of the Buddha’s speech

Reflect on the marvelous manner of the Buddha’s speech. Even if

every living being in the universe asks him a different question at

the same time, he comprehends them all with one instant of his

wisdom. Then he answers all the questions with a single word,

which all beings understand in their own languages.

Because you see the truth, your speech never misleads;

Since it is faultless, it is correct;

Since it is well-composed, it is easy to understand.

Your words are well-spoken.

At first your speech

Captivates the listeners’ minds;

Then if they give it thought,

It clears away attachment and delusion.

It relieves the destitute,

Protects the unruly,

And induces the reveler to renounce

Your speech accords with everyone’s needs.

It delights the learned,

Improves the minds of the middling,

And dispels the darkness of the lowly.

This speech is medicine for all living beings.
